Abstract:
An intrusion point identification device includes: a threat information collector that collects and stores threat information including identification information identifying a moving body, route information indicating a route through which the threat has intruded into the moving body, and discovery information indicating a discovery date of an attack; a vehicle log collector that collects logs, extracts, from the logs, histories of points that indicate locations of one or more moving bodies within a predetermined period, and stores the histories of the points as history information, the logs indicating points that indicate locations of the one or more moving bodies, the predetermined period being set based on the discovery information; an intrusion point identification unit that identifies an intrusion point of the threat from a first attack source through a first route among the points indicated in the history information; and an intrusion point notifier that outputs the intrusion point.
